Symptoms of ADHD

ADHD is a mental disorder that affects many children. The symptoms can range from hyperactivity to inattentiveness. It may also co-exist with other disorders. In addition, it may be difficult to recognize the disorder. Inadequate diagnosis can cause poor performance in school and at work. ADHD can lead to problems in social relationships. Children with ADHD are usually easily distracted and may jump from activities without finishing an assignment. They may also omit instructions and avoid tasks that require mental focus. Teachers and private adhd assessment Somerset parents can find this frustrating.

Adults suffering from ADHD often find it difficult to get to sleep or get to work on time. They may also suffer from short-term memory problems and other problems. When diagnosed, the condition is treatable.

ADHD can make it difficult for adults to keep up with expenses, make and maintain friends, and remain focused. ADHD can also affect a person's ability to focus on studies. A test can help you determine if you have ADHD.

Get the most accurate diagnosis for your child

A private Adhd assessment somerset adhd evaluation could be an option if are worried about your child's behavior. This is the first step towards helping your child manage their symptoms. ADHD is a neurological disorder that affects brain function.

The diagnosis of a child suffering from ADHD can be difficult. A health professional has to rule out possible causes of the behavior.

A number of tests are performed by a doctor or clinician to establish the diagnosis. A full physical exam is one of the examples of the tests. Tests also include vision and hearing tests. The Conners Rating Scale is a commonly used questionnaire. It asks the patient about their social life, behavior, and work.

The Continuous Performance Test is another test. It evaluates the ability of a child to complete a task repeatedly over time.

American Academy of Pediatrics recommends that parents and children ask about their child's behavior. School psychologists can assist in determining whether ADHD symptoms are hindering the child's ability to learn. They can also suggest modifications to the family's routine.

Refusing to accept treatment that doesn’t deal with the cause

Many teens are nervous about being diagnosed with ADHD. This is a typical issue. This disorder is often difficult to diagnose and can be accompanied by anxiety or depression symptoms. Adherence to medication can be complicated by a comorbid mood disorder, substance abuse or other issues. To help a child learn to accept the condition and its treatment parents must help them understand the difficulties and responsibilities that come with ADHD.

One of the biggest issues faced by teens with ADHD is ensuring that they adhere to their medication. ADHD sufferers often take stimulant medications incorrectly. They are utilized for performance enhancement rather than treat the root cause of the problem. It is important to investigate if a child refuses the medication prescribed. ADHD adolescents may also suffer from other mood disorders that are comorbid, like bipolar disorder. Teens may also develop addiction issues, which can make adhering to prescribed medications more difficult.
